1. A trusted vehicle message system, comprising:

  • a vehicle body having one or more body parts;

    one or more displays supported by the one or more body parts of the vehicle body and positioned to be readable from outside the vehicle body; and

    a vehicle computer disposed inside the vehicle body, the vehicle computer including;

    a communication interface, implemented at least partly in one or more of configurable logic or fixed-functionality logic hardware, to receive a communication from one or more of an internal vehicle component or an external communication system;

    a message composer, implemented at least partly in one or more of configurable logic or fixed-functionality logic hardware, communicatively coupled to the communication interface to compose a trusted message to be displayed in response to the received communication; and

    a display manager, implemented at least partly in one or more of configurable logic or fixed-functionality logic hardware, communicatively coupled to the communication interface, the message composer, and the one or more displays to manage a content to be displayed on the one or more displays, wherein the display manager is to automatically determine, via a sensor, a position of a first viewer relative to the vehicle body,wherein the display manager is to manage the content so that the trusted message is to be displayed on the one or more displays to be readable by the first viewer in response to the position of the first viewer being determined as inside the vehicle body regardless of whether a second viewer is identified by the system as being outside the vehicle body, and to automatically reverse a readable direction of the trusted message on the one or more displays in response to the position of the first viewer being determined as no longer inside the vehicle body so that the trusted message is displayed in the reversed readable direction irrespective of the position of the first viewer, that is outside the vehicle body, relative to the one or more displays and the vehicle body.
